Intel

Pentium N3530

The Pentium N3530 is manufactured by Intel. It was released in 2007-01-01. It is based on the Bay Trail-M (2013βˆ’2014) architecture. It features 4 cores and 4 threads. Base frequency is 2.16 GHz, with boost up to 2.58 GHz. L3 cache: 2 MB. L2 cache: 2 MB. Built on 22 nm process technology. Socket: FCBGA1170. Thermal design power (TDP): 7.5 Watt. Memory support: DDR3L-1333. Passmark benchmark score: 1,159 points. Launch price was $69.

AMD

Sempron 3850

The Sempron 3850 is manufactured by AMD. It was released in 2007-01-01. It is based on the Kabini (2013βˆ’2014) architecture. It features 4 cores and 4 threads. Max frequency: 1.3 GHz. L2 cache: 2048 kB. Built on 28 nm process technology. Socket: AM1. Thermal design power (TDP): 25 Watt. Memory support: DDR3-1600. Passmark benchmark score: 1,168 points. Launch price was $69.

Processing Power

Both the Pentium N3530 and Sempron 3850 share an identical 4-core/4-thread configuration. Boost clocks reach 2.58 GHz on the Pentium N3530 versus 1.3 GHz on the Sempron 3850 β€” a 66% clock advantage for the Pentium N3530. The Pentium N3530 uses the Bay Trail-M (2013βˆ’2014) architecture (22 nm), while the Sempron 3850 uses Kabini (2013βˆ’2014) (28 nm). In PassMark, the Pentium N3530 scores 1,159 against the Sempron 3850's 1,168 β€” a 0.8% lead for the Sempron 3850.
